Thank you to those coordinators that were able to attend our May meeting.  Here are some notes from the meeting.  These will also be emailed to coordinators.

  1. The new playing time rules implemented for the spring 2023 season are going great and will become permanent moving forward.
  2. We discussed the fall 2023 season and decided that any type of club activities in October do not need to be avoided.  Therefore, we are returning back to starting the season the weekend after Labor Day.  Finalized timelines are on the front page of the web site.
  3. The preseason tournament will take place the weekend of Aug 26/27.  This is a three match round robin.
  4. The league will help put on a coaches clinic either the 2nd or 3rd weekend in August.  More details to come on this.
  5. Boys volleyball continues to grow.  We have commitments from 4 teams to start a boys 3rd/4th grade division in the fall so we will plan on offering it.
  6. The girls 5th/6th grade athletic divisions will now be split into grade specific divisions.  We may or may not have enough teams to support A and B divisions for each grade but we will offer it.  Most likely we will be able to support 6th athletic A and B and also 5th athletic.  In the spring, due to lower number of athletic teams, we will probably only be able to support 6th athletic and 5th athletic.
  7. The spring 2024 season will begin the weekend after Easter (1st weekend in April) and run for 6 weeks followed by a season-ending tournament the weekend before Memorial day weekend.
  8. League fees are being increased to $105/team, ref fees will remain unchanged at $15/match per team.
